1. background and development of on-line poker Ranking:
Internet poker ranking methods first emerged in the early 2000s, shortly after the poker increase. In those days, platforms like Sharkscope and Official Poker Rankings (OPR) gained popularity by tracking and displaying people’ tournament outcomes and earnings. These systems primarily dedicated to supplying data to assist players evaluate their particular overall performance and get an advantage over their opponents.
But as internet poker became much more competitive, ranking systems started integrating additional elements eg leaderboard tournaments and player score methods. This change directed to foster a feeling of competition, pushing people to shoot for higher positioning and recognition from their particular colleagues.
2. Different Sorts Of On-line Poker Ranking Techniques:
These days, people have access to numerous on-line poker ranking methods that use diverse methodologies in assessing people' shows. While some methods concentrate on money game results, other people prioritize competition accomplishments or a mix of both.
One widely used standing system is the Global Poker Index (GPI), which gained extensive recognition due to its unbiased and precise analysis methods. The GPI uses a scoring formula that weighs in at tournaments' buy-ins, field sizes, and people' completing roles. Consequently, the device gift suggestions an objective ranking that ranks players considering their constant overall performance in prestigious real time tournaments.
